At the entrance to the reception hall, Xiao Yan bared his fangs as he stared at everyone inside. Forget Wu Tao and the others from the Lin Clan—even Lin Zhentian and the rest, who were familiar with him, felt their hearts leap into their throats.

After all, two or three months ago, Xiao Yan had not been this large, nor had he possessed such a terrifying aura.

As for the members of the Lin Clan, they were all so frightened that cold sweat broke out over them. Though they came from the Lin Clan, they could not be considered core clan members, and their status was not particularly high.

Not to mention that among them, the strongest were the woman and the young man, whose strength was only that of a Three Symbol Talisman Master and the Lesser Perfection of the Yuan Dan Realm. When had they ever seen a demonic beast at the Primal Core Realm Great Perfection so up close?

Moreover, Xiao Yan was different from ordinary demonic beasts at the Primal Core Realm Great Perfection. Not only did he have a mutated bloodline, but he also possessed traces of some high-grade bloodlines within him.

As everyone knew, among demonic beasts, dragons and phoenixes both possessed top-tier bloodlines. Any demonic beast tainted with even a trace of dragon or phoenix bloodline would be among the best of its level.

In addition, the combat strength of tiger-type demonic beasts was likewise extremely formidable among those of the same level.

As luck would have it, Xiao Yan himself belonged to the Tiger Clan, and within him were also faint traces of both Dragon Clan and Phoenix Clan bloodlines. His strength was enough to rival an ordinary demonic beast at the Lesser Success of the Form Creation Realm.

Before Xiao Yan, among this group from the Lin Clan, only the white-clothed woman and Wu Tao had even a slight ability to resist. As for the others, Xiao Yan could practically take them down one with each claw.

Seeing that Xiao Yan had cowed this group of high-and-mighty inner clan members from the Lin Clan, Lin Dong immediately said to Xiao Yan, "Xiao Yan, if you can't come in, wait outside for now."

"Wuu!"

Hearing this, Xiao Yan let out a low whine, then had no choice but to slowly retreat. Immediately afterward, he simply lay down on the spot, sprawling on the ground outside the hall.

"Whew!"

Only after seeing Xiao Yan quietly lie down did Wu Tao and the others let out a long breath of relief.

Seeing this, Lin Feng and the others also exhaled deeply. Right after that, lingering fear appeared on their faces, and once they came back to themselves, they were even more shocked to realize that their backs were already completely soaked.

"As expected, heroes really do come from the young. With such an outstanding grandson, old friend, it shouldn't be long before your wish can be fulfilled."

After Wu Tao recovered, he could not help but speak with a smile. As he spoke, he sized up Lin Dong with a face full of surprise.

At first glance, he had not noticed anything—but once he looked carefully, he was startled.

From Lin Dong, Wu Tao actually sensed an extremely dangerous aura, as if the one sitting before him were not a young man at all, but the fierce tiger outside.

As expected of a genius capable of raising such a powerful demonic beast. Even if his own strength can't compare to that fierce tiger, I'm afraid he isn't much weaker than me!

Wu Tao was secretly shocked, and equally shocked was the white-clothed woman.

The white-clothed woman was named Lin Ke'er. Among this group of young people, she held both the highest status and the greatest strength.

In Lin Ke'er's perception, Lin Dong was like a mysterious black hole. After her Spiritual Power spread toward him, it actually vanished in a strange manner.

"You must be Lin Dong, right? My name is Lin Ke'er. Your strength is quite impressive. I look forward to your performance at the clan gathering two years from now."

Lin Ke'er took the initiative to greet him, causing Lin Dong to pause for a moment before he smiled and replied, "Thank you. You're very strong too."

As Wu Tao and Lin Ke'er spoke, everyone in the hall gradually came back to their senses. The way the young people from the Lin Clan looked at Lin Dong also clearly changed.

Seeing this, Lin Zhentian could not help but chuckle. Pointing to the empty seat closest to him, he said with a beaming smile, "Dong'er, come, sit down. I'll introduce you. This is an old friend of Grandpa's from back when I was in the clan. His name is Wu Tao. You can just call him Old Mister Tao."

"Old Mister Tao!"

Lin Dong called out rather politely, and an innocent, harmless expression appeared on his face. But how could Wu Tao dare to be negligent? He hurriedly replied, "No need to be so polite. If you don't mind, just call me Elder Tao."

As he spoke, Wu Tao could not help turning to look at Lin Zhentian and said with a smile, "Old friend, I understand what you're thinking. You want Lin Dong to accompany us to the Tianyan Mountain Range for training. However, this matter isn't up to me. It depends on Lin Dong's wishes."

Lin Chen, who was seated there, along with Lin Feng and the others standing nearby, moved their lips, but in the end, none of them said a word.

Going to the Ancient Tomb Mansion was a matter for inner clan members like them. Wu Tao, as a steward, was essentially the guard and leader of their group.

Logically speaking, this sort of matter should not allow an outer clan member to interfere, slip into their team, and take the chance to gain benefits.

Yet unfortunately, Lin Dong's strength far surpassed theirs. If he joined their team, not only would he not be a burden—rather, they would become burdens to him.

After all, with Lin Dong's strength, even if he entered the mountains alone, his safety would be greatly assured. A demonic beast at the Primal Core Realm Great Perfection could play a far greater role in the mountains than a human expert at the Primal Core Realm Great Perfection.

"Dong'er, what do you think?"

Lin Zhentian did not make the decision for Lin Dong, but instead handed the choice to him.

Upon hearing this, Lin Dong did not hesitate in the slightest and replied, "Grandpa, if we're going to the Ancient Tomb Mansion, then there may need to be one more person."

"You really are stupid, kid. It's not like you're the one begging them right now, so why are you acting so timid? Bring the people from the Wanjin Merchant Association along too!"

As soon as Lin Dong finished speaking, Little Marten's voice rang out in his mind, reminding him.

Lin Dong, however, looked completely puzzled, making Little Marten so angry that he immediately rolled his eyes and explained, "Kid, Lord Marten will teach you something. Remember this: when you're out in the world, don't trust others easily, even if they're from the same clan. Especially since you've already made enemies of these arrogant bastards. If they stab you in the back while you're fighting over treasures, you'll be finished!"

A chill ran down Lin Dong's back when he heard this, and his expression grew a little more serious. He hurriedly said, "Of course, if possible, it would be best if we could go together with the people from the Wanjin Merchant Association."

Lin Zhentian was an old hand as well, and he instantly understood what Lin Dong meant. He hurriedly chimed in.

"Old friend, my Lin family was able to rise thanks in large part to the Wanjin Merchant Association's help. Dong'er is also on very good terms with them. What do you think?"

Wu Tao naturally understood what Lin Zhentian was thinking, but he did not refuse. Instead, he agreed with a smile.

"That works too. With more people traveling together, it'll be a bit safer."

As far as Wu Tao was concerned, it naturally made no difference. Having to protect this group of young masters on his own was quite a tiring task, and if there were others traveling with them, it would naturally be even safer.

Moreover, Wu Tao had also looked into the Wanjin Merchant Association's strength, and he was fairly reassured about this merchant association.
